Christopher Stowell is the current artistic director. Prior to joining Oregon Ballet Theatre in 2003, he was a principal dancer with San Francisco Ballet for 16 years. During Stowell's tenure, the company has added the work of Sir Frederick Ashton, Jerome Robbins, William Forsythe, Lar Lubovitch and Christopher Wheeldon to its repertoire. New works have been created on the company by James Kudelka, Trey McIntyre, Yuri Possokhov, Julia Adam and Nicolo Fonte. In addition, Christopher Stowell has choreographed eight new ballets with the company's dancers.
